Pokemon Anime Director Says “We May See Ash Again” In The Future

Earlier this year, The Pokemon Company announced that Ash would be stepping down as the main character of the Pokemon Anime series after 25 years in the role.

In an interview published by Japanese magazine Otomedia, Pokemon anime director Kunihiko Yuyama discussed Ash’s departure from the series. Aside from sharing tidbits about the including the “Far Off Blue Sky” anime special and “Aim To Be A Pokemon Master” limited series, Yuyama also hinted that these might not be the last time we see Ash in the anime, stating that “we’ll see Ash again somewhere in the future.”.
